Where Tax Accountants in Great Bend, KS Serve

Great Bend, KS is a vibrant city located in the heart of Kansas. It is home to many notable landmarks, such as the Great Bend Zoo and Brit Spaugh Park, which offer residents and visitors alike a chance to explore the natural beauty of the area. The city also boasts a thriving business community, with top employers including Great Bend Regional Hospital, Barton Community College, and USD 428. Major highways and streets in the area include US-56 and US-281, which provide easy access to nearby cities and towns. In terms of neighborhoods, Great Bend is known for its diverse mix of residential areas, from the historic downtown district to newer developments like Stone Lake Estates and Prairie Estates. Overall, Great Bend is a dynamic and welcoming community that offers something for everyone.

Estate Planning Lawyer

Residents of Great Bend, KS could greatly benefit from the services of an estate planning lawyer. These legal professionals specialize in helping individuals plan for the transfer of their assets and property after they pass away. In Great Bend, where many residents own farms or agricultural land, an estate planning lawyer can help ensure that these assets are transferred to the intended beneficiaries without any legal complications. Additionally, an estate planning lawyer can assist with creating trusts and other legal instruments that can help protect assets from creditors or ensure that they are used for specific purposes, such as funding a child's education. With their expertise in estate law and their knowledge of Great Bend's unique circumstances, an estate planning lawyer can provide invaluable assistance to residents looking to secure their financial future and protect their assets for future generations.
